Wins These Things 4 beat projections, earn win over STINGERS in 111.3-90.2 runaway

Wins These Things 4 showed up, rolling to a 111.3-90.2 victory over STINGERS, who fell short of projections. STINGERS grabbed a 21.2-point lead on Thursday behind impressive performances from Miles Sanders (15.3 points) and Dameon Pierce (13.9). But it was all Wins These Things 4 after that. They were led by Josh Allen, who passed for 205 yards and ran for 86 yards and 2 touchdowns for 26.8 points, and Mecole Hardman, who caught 6 passes for 79 yards and a touchdown (16.9 points). Wins These Things 4 (7-2) will look to sustain their winning ways against bobtoo999's Optimal Team, while STINGERS (3-6) will attempt to get back in the win column against BULLDOG.

Matchup Player of the Week

Hardman (6 Rec, 79 Rec Yds, 1 Rec TD) scored 16.9 points in a 20-17 win over the Titans in Week 9. His scoring output more-than-doubled his 6.63-point projection and was much higher than his 8.45-point season scoring average. Hardman ranks #95 among all fantasy players this season and will face the Jaguars next week.
